随着区块链技术的发展,Web3作为互联网的未来方向,引起了越来越多人的关注。Web3代表了去中心化网络的理念,旨在通过区块链技术提升用户的数据安全性和隐私保护。然而,尽管Web3的理念吸引人,很多人仍然对其了解不深,特别是在技术学习和社区交流方面。本文将探讨一些优秀的学习与交流渠道,并解答与Web3相关的常见问题,以帮助读者更好地融入这一新兴领域。
Web3是一种去中心化的网络架构,与传统的Web2.0有所不同。它允许用户拥有数据的控制权,去掉中介,从而提高了透明度和安全性。因此,学习Web3不仅能够提升个人技术水平,还有助于职业发展。随着更多企业开始采用去中心化布局,对于具备Web3技术的人才需求会越来越大。
在学习Web3的过程中,我们需要选择合适的平台。以下是一些推荐的学习资源:
除了学习,交流也是深化理解的重要过程。以下是一些推荐的Web3交流社区:
学习Web3并没有严格的门槛,但有一些基础知识会帮助你更快上手。首先,了解区块链的基本概念是必要的。需要掌握的关键概念包括分布式账本、共识机制、加密货币的运作等。
其次,熟悉编程语言也是重要的一步。目前,许多Web3应用都是建立在以太坊平台上,因此,学习Solidity(以太坊的智能合约语言)是非常有帮助的。此外,了解JavaScript、Python等编程语言的基础内容也会让你在开发和应用上更加得心应手。
最后,建议了解一些网络安全知识。由于Web3技术涉及到大量的用户数据和财务交易,掌握网络安全相关的知识可以帮助你更好地理解如何保护用户的隐私和数据安全。
Web3的核心理念在于去中心化,相比现有的Web2.0,用户在Web3中拥有更多的控制权。在Web2.0中,许多平台(如社交媒体和在线服务)由特定公司控制,用户的数据和信息往往被集中管理。用户无法完全掌控自己的数据,而是被迫信任这些平台。
而Web3通过区块链和去中心化应用(DApps)来改变这一现状。在Web3中,用户数据和资产被存储在区块链上,嵌入在智能合约中,允许用户直接与彼此交互,而不需要依赖中介。这种模式带来了更好的透明度和安全性,让用户拥有了对自己数据的完全控制权。此外,Web3的经济机制也不同于Web2.0,很多Web3项目通过代币化等方式,激励用户参与并分享平台的价值。
Web3的快速发展正在重塑很多行业的格局,包括金融、游戏、社交、艺术等。对于专业人士来说,熟悉Web3技术将变得越发重要。根据相关数据,未来几年内,区块链开发者、智能合约审计师、去中心化金融(DeFi)分析师等岗位的需求预计将会急剧增加。
此外,Web3还将催生一些新的职业,例如NFT艺术家、DAO组织管理者和社区经理。这些职位都将需要具备一定的Web3技术知识或相关领域的经验,对于求职者来说,掌握Web3技能将大大提升其在职场的竞争力。
另外,Web3也在推动工作方式的改变,许多公司已经开始采用远程工作的模式,Web3技术的使用减少了对中心化管理的依赖,提供了更为灵活和分散的工作环境。这种工作方式的变化将会影响人们对工作的看法和选择。
若想成为Web3开发者,应该掌握一些关键技能。第一,了解区块链技术及其工作原理,包括分布式账本、共识机制等。对此可以通过阅读相关书籍和参加在线课程来增强理解。
第二,编程技能不可或缺。了解如何使用Solidity编写智能合约是成为以太坊开发者的基础。此外,熟悉JavaScript、Python、Go等语言会使你在进行Web3应用开发时更加灵活。
第三,掌握与区块链交互的方法,例如使用Web3.js(JavaScript库)或ethers.js等库。这些工具可以帮助开发者更方便地与以太坊网络进行交互。
最后,了解去中心化金融(DeFi)和非同质化代币(NFT)的基本概念和工作原理,这将为你开发基于Web3的产品或项目奠定基础。
在Web3领域,投资或参与一个项目前,对其潜力的评估是至关重要的。首先要关注项目的团队背景。一个成功的项目通常有具有相关经验的开发者和社区管理者,他们在区块链技术领域有过成功的经历。
其次,查看项目的白皮书。白皮书是项目理念与路线图的详细说明,能够反映出项目的技术可行性和市场需求。
第三,分析社区的活跃度。一个好的Web3项目需要有活跃的社区支持,用户参与度和讨论频率都是判断项目潜力的重要指标。
最后,评估项目的技术实现。了解其代码库的活跃程度、开源性质和技术创新性,有助于判断一个项目是否具备可持续发展的能力。
通过以上学习与交流的方式,相信你能够逐步深入Web3这个充满潜力的领域,实现自我提升,结识更多志同道合的朋友。
2003-2025 tp官方下载安卓最新版本2025 @版权所有|网站地图|浙ICP备2024065162号